**Webhook retries — Lanternpost**

Deliveries retry on 5xx or timeout. Backoff: 1m, 5m, 30m, 2h, then dead-letter. 4xx responses are not retried. Endpoints failing for 72 hours get auto-disabled. Don't replay dead-letters manually without checking idempotency keys. Replay tooling is behind the ops vault; to open it you'll need the team recovery passphrase, which is:

strongbox words: wenix-ulador

**Runbook: Timetabler release step 6 — sign the solver artifact**

After the Periodix constraint-solver build passes the full regression suite (including the split-lunch and double-block scenarios), export the release tarball to the staging vault. Confirm the checksum matches the build log before proceeding. Sign the artifact exactly once; duplicate signatures will fail validation. Use the release signing key below.

deploy key for kajof-fajop: bky6_gDHw9Q

## Deploying the Tidewatcher Widget

Welcome aboard! The tide-table widget ships as a single static bundle plus a tiny config file. Build it with the standard make target, push the bundle to the Saltmere CDN bucket, and bump the version pin in the host page. That's genuinely it — no servers to babysit. The widget expects the configuration values below.

deployment values, yahag-tawef:
ZORWYN_HOST=zorwyn.tolvaqlabs.internal
ZORWYN_PORT=9300

Subject: DR drill — password reset revamp (Pellgrove v4)

Hi plugin authors,

Next Thursday we run a disaster-recovery drill against the revamped Pellgrove password reset flow. Plugins hooking the reset-token lifecycle must tolerate a 90-second outage window and replayed webhook events. Please verify your handlers are idempotent beforehand. During the drill, the sandbox vault will be sealed; to reopen your test tenant, use the recovery passphrase below.

vault phrase of taweg-kafof = oliax-zorael